react ui developer
Quantiphi
About the role
About Quantiphi
Quantiphi is an award-winning, AI-First digital engineering and consulting company focused on delivering high-impact Services and Solutions that help organizations solve what truly matters. We partner with enterprises to reimagine their businesses through intelligent, scalable, and transformative AI driving measurable outcomes at the very core of their operations.
Since our founding in 2013, Quantiphi has tackled some of the world’s most complex business challenges by combining deep industry expertise, disciplined cloud and data engineering practices, and cutting-edge applied AI research. Our work is rooted in delivering accelerated, quantifiable business value, not just technology for technology’s sake.
Headquartered in Boston, Quantiphi is a global organization with 4,000+ professionals serving clients across key industry verticals including BFSI, Healthcare & Life Sciences, Consumer Goods, Manufacturing, and Technology, Media & Entertainment.
As an Elite and Premier partner to leading cloud and AI platforms such as NVIDIA, Google Cloud, AWS, and Snowflake, we build and deliver enterprise-grade AI services and solutions that create real-world impact.
We’ve been recognized with:
● 17x Google Cloud Partner of the Year awards in the last 8 years
● 3x AWS AI/ML award wins
● 3x NVIDIA Partner of the Year titles
● 2x Snowflake Partner of the Year awards
● Top analyst recognitions from Gartner, ISG, and Everest Group
● Industry-leading AI accelerators across Generative AI, Agentic AI, Data, and Cloud
We have also been certified as a Great Place to Work for multiple consecutive years.
Be part of a trailblazing team that’s shaping the future of AI, ML, and cloud innovation.
Your next big opportunity starts here!
Role: React UI Developer
Experience Level: 4–8 Years
Location: New Brunswick, Canada
Work Model: Hybrid
Candidate Location Requirement: Only candidates currently based in Atlantic Canada will be considered.
Job Summary
We are seeking a skilled React UI Developer to design and build modern, responsive, and high-performing user interfaces for enterprise-grade web applications.
This role will focus heavily on frontend development using React, TypeScript, JavaScript, HTML, and CSS, while working closely with backend developers, product managers, designers, and QA teams.
The ideal candidate should have a strong eye for UI/UX, experience building reusable components, and the ability to translate design concepts into scalable, production-ready interfaces.
Roles & Responsibilities
● Develop responsive and user-friendly web applications using React.
● Build reusable UI components and frontend libraries for scalable application development.
● Collaborate with UX/UI designers to translate wireframes and mockups into high-quality user experiences.
● Work closely with backend developers to integrate APIs and ensure smooth end-to-end functionality.
● Optimize applications for maximum speed, performance, responsiveness, and cross-browser compatibility.
● Write clean, maintainable, and well-documented code following frontend development best practices.
● Implement state management solutions using Redux, Context API, or similar libraries.
● Ensure accessibility, responsiveness, and mobile-friendly design standards are met.
● Participate in code reviews, testing, debugging, and troubleshooting.
● Contribute to CI/CD workflows, deployment activities, and frontend release processes.
● Stay current with frontend development trends, UI frameworks, and modern engineering practices.
Required Skills & Qualifications
● 4–8 years of experience in frontend or UI development.
● Strong hands-on experience with React, JavaScript, and TypeScript.
● Solid understanding of HTML5, CSS3, responsive design, and frontend architecture.
● Experience with state management libraries such as Redux, Context API, or Zustand.
● Experience integrating REST APIs and working with backend services.
● Familiarity with frontend testing frameworks such as Jest, React Testing Library, or Cypress.
● Experience with version control tools such as Git, GitHub, or GitLab.
● Understanding of CI/CD processes and frontend deployment workflows.
● Familiarity with component libraries, design systems, and reusable UI patterns.
● Strong knowledge of browser debugging tools and frontend performance optimization.
● Experience working in Agile or Scrum environments.
● Strong communication and collaboration skills with the ability to work effectively in a hybrid model.
Nice to Have Skills
● Experience with Next.js or other React-based frameworks.
● Familiarity with Tailwind CSS, Material UI, Bootstrap, or similar styling frameworks.
● Exposure to cloud platforms such as AWS, Azure, or GCP.
● Experience with accessibility standards and WCAG compliance.
● Knowledge of frontend build tools such as Webpack, Vite, or Babel.
● Understanding of GraphQL and WebSockets.
● Experience working on enterprise or customer-facing digital products.
What Is In It For You
● Opportunity to work on modern enterprise UI applications with global teams.
● Exposure to large-scale frontend engineering projects and best practices.
● Hybrid work model in New Brunswick with a collaborative team environment.
● Opportunity to work with the latest frontend technologies and design systems.
● Career growth, continuous learning, and exposure to enterprise-grade digital transformation initiatives.
Requirements
- 4–8 years of experience in frontend or UI development.
- Strong hands-on experience with React, JavaScript, and TypeScript.
- Solid understanding of HTML5, CSS3, responsive design, and frontend architecture.
- Experience with state management libraries such as Redux, Context API, or Zustand.
- Experience integrating REST APIs and working with backend services.
- Familiarity with frontend testing frameworks such as Jest, React Testing Library, or Cypress.
- Experience with version control tools such as Git, GitHub, or GitLab.
- Understanding of CI/CD processes and frontend deployment workflows.
- Familiarity with component libraries, design systems, and reusable UI patterns.
- Strong knowledge of browser debugging tools and frontend performance optimization.
- Experience working in Agile or Scrum environments.
- Strong communication and collaboration skills with the ability to work effectively in a hybrid model.
Responsibilities
- Develop responsive and user-friendly web applications using React.
- Build reusable UI components and frontend libraries for scalable application development.
- Collaborate with UX/UI designers to translate wireframes and mockups into high-quality user experiences.
- Work closely with backend developers to integrate APIs and ensure smooth end-to-end functionality.
- Optimize applications for maximum speed, performance, responsiveness, and cross-browser compatibility.
- Write clean, maintainable, and well-documented code following frontend development best practices.
- Implement state management solutions using Redux, Context API, or similar libraries.
- Ensure accessibility, responsiveness, and mobile-friendly design standards are met.
- Participate in code reviews, testing, debugging, and troubleshooting.
- Contribute to CI/CD workflows, deployment activities, and frontend release processes.
- Stay current with frontend development trends, UI frameworks, and modern engineering practices.
Benefits
Skills
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free